English-Italian translation for "ghettoization"
"ghettoization" Italian translation
Results: 1-2 of 2
ghettoization {noun}
ghettoization {noun}
ghettoization {noun}
Similar words
Have a look at the English-French dictionary by bab.la.
ghettoization {noun}
ghettoization {noun}
Have a look at the English-French dictionary by bab.la.